Meanings of underpinned

  • verb
    1. To support from below with props or masonry.
    2. To give support to; to corroborate.

Example Sentences

  • Their arguments were underpinned by extensive scientific research.
  • The success of the project was underpinned by careful planning.
  • Her confidence was underpinned by years of experience in the field.
  • The structure was underpinned to prevent further collapse.
  • Economic reforms were underpinned by strong public support.
